Linux
在 /etc/hosts 中包含所有常用和重要的地址是否好?
將所有常用主機和公司重要主機包含在其中通常被認為是好還是壞
/etc/hosts
?現在我可以看到以下優點和缺點:
- 優點:提高速度、流量、可靠性、安全性
- 缺點:降低可管理性
在我看來,您對主機文件條目的依賴越少越好。最好使用像 DNS 這樣的自動化系統。你的騙局是正確的——它降低了可管理性。當事情發生變化時,它也容易出錯。不止一次,我知道人們花費大量時間嘗試調試他們認為是 DNS 問題,卻發現有一個主機條目導致了這一切。
至於您的專業人士,我認為除非您有其他更重要的網路問題,否則不應注意到微小的速度差異。DNS 查詢產生的流量是如此微不足道,如果它完全考慮在內,您將再次遇到嚴重的網路問題。沒有真正的安全優勢。恰恰相反,如果機器失去或被盜,您可能會提供其他情況下無法獲得的資訊。